Project description

Third-cycle subject: Engineering mechanics.

People with disabilities are the largest minority group in the world. Despite this, we as scientists have relatively little ability to prevent the long-term downward spiral which occurs when their primary disability causes secondary consequences on the body.

This PhD student project is part of a larger project BADASS (Biomechanics of motion disorders and assistance): Through efficient collaboration between new and established multiprofessional networks, the BADASS project will build up fundamental knowledge of tissue and systemic behavior in people with disabilities through studies that span several biological scales. This PhD project aims to design and develop robotic aids that complement one's physical function and give one the opportunity to locomote and perform daily activities optimally according to one's abilities. We focus on soft, compliant tools for the lower extremities. The doctoral student shall, through simulation-based design and prototyping, develop devices that sense and provide assistance-as-needed that complements the user's own abilities. The devices should reduce the users' metabolic energy demands and increase their ability to perform daily activities.

The project is funded by the Swedish Research Council and by the Promobilia Foundation. The target group includes individuals with physical disabilities due to pathology, injury or age.
